ManpowerGroup (MAN), a global leader in workforce solutions and staffing services, is trading at $29.35 as of April 2, 2026, posting a single-session gain of 2.12% at the time of writing. This analysis explores key technical levels, recent market context, and potential price scenarios for the stock, as investor attention turns to shifting labor market dynamics and broader macroeconomic trends impacting the staffing sector.
